The movie draws out how theinfected humans that in all appearance seem to have undergone de-evolution to total anarchy and basic animal instinct are as sane(though a bit more primitive) than the normal uninfected human. They seem to appear de-evolved from the human perspective however on a closer look they display emotion, protectiveness and advanced survival tactics in a very human and also non-human way. The movie is well made with advanced graphics making New York, the Big Apple, only a sprawling city in ruins reclaimed by nature where wildlife roam free like the African Savannah.
The storyline is beautifully brought out in all its poignancy where the lead protagonist Dr. Neville is played by a gaunt, yet well built, Will Smith. Will Smiths daughter, Willow Smith, also stars as the doctors daughter Marley. The movie brings out the humanness of a determined doctor while he tries to save humanity from thedisease, having for company only his German Shepherd dog Samantha. It is a movie about faith and determination, science as against/with a higher divine order(portrayed by Anna).
